Output a656c886f152fc5ba6909b59a36fa225c827079bf08b5e760360f00845addb94:4

value
681235
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1fcb8efda91d33dad0b4db522b432b7359fc329a OP_EQUAL
address
34b8izCjQK6db9gE6g82djdLqsZAwVNkYk
transaction
a656c886f152fc5ba6909b59a36fa225c827079bf08b5e760360f00845addb94
spent
true